The picture of him receiving the freedom of the city might hang beside another of his winning the Arst "leg" of his Grand Stain, the outstanding golfing achievemeni of all time, 20 years betare.

Visitors to the exhibition will be asked to pay Bd. or a 1s. entrance fee and the proceeds, by a particularly happy thought, will go to the Joint Links Committee to help with the upkeep of the four courses.

They will also help towards the salary of the gentleman who is to be appointed to supervise all green-keeping when the pre- sent head green-keeper retires. The special problems presented by courses which suffer the battering of upwards of 50,000 rounds a year make this a most desimble move,

The same firm hopes to revize and enlarge the book- Iel, with which many readers will be familiar, on "How to Play the Old. Course.”

I think this is well worth while because this historic and wonder links does offer 1 challenge that is not only more dmcult than others but also completely different.

Unique

I have no longer any doubt that it is the greatest course in the world, but it takes a good many rounds before this begins! lo dawn on you, and the average viellor, with insufficient time, tentie to go away extremely ala- appointed. unable to remember

one hole from another. Few masterpieces are appreciated at first sight or fit hearing.

It took me scrie years before

I suddenly realfand what it is that makes the Old course mique-hamely that it is the only course is the world without a separute fairway for cath hole. It consists of a strip of going ground which you use both going it and coming, in, with twe flags on coch green..
